When I teach my students about ISO, I always tell them to think of what use the photos are for. If they are just family 'snapshots' etc., where they will likely only be printed small & stuck to the fridge...or end up on Facebook etc., then it's unlikely that too much noise will ruin the photos.

If you are a professional, on the other hand, and expected to hand over clean, high quality photos....then that's different.
